Can I do cycling after leg workout?

Cycling is a great form of cardio that can help you burn calories and improve your cardiovascular health. It's also a low-impact activity, making it a good option for people with joint pain or injuries. However, if you've just finished a leg workout, you may be wondering if it's okay to go for a bike ride.

The answer is yes, but there are a few things you should keep in mind. First, if your legs are very sore, it's best to wait a day or two before cycling. This will give your muscles time to recover and prevent further soreness. Second, when you do go for a bike ride, start out slowly and gradually increase the intensity. This will help prevent muscle strain. Finally, be sure to listen to your body and stop if you experience any pain.

Cycling after a leg workout can be a great way to improve your overall fitness. Just be sure to listen to your body and take it easy.
